The Program Quality Manager is responsible for programs from the point of Quality Agreement signature through program closure. This role ensures FUJIFILM Biotechnologies, Holly Springs provides services in alignment with our contracted commitment to clients and our company vision/mission (strategy and compliance). This role is the primary client liaison representing FUJIFILM Biotechnologies, Holly Springs Quality. The Program Quality Manager handles and/or supports an average load of 1-3 client programs.
WhatYou'll Do
- Acts as a Quality liaison and project team member between the client and FUJIFILM Biotechnologies, Holly Springs.
- Supports and/or leads the planning and execution of programs in alignment with Quality Agreements (vision, mission, strategy-goals-objectives).
- Ensures that the quality agreement is organized based on segments of work and regulatory requirements including FDA, EU, and other regulatory agencies and engages impacted functional areas for inputs to ensure the quality agreement elements are complete and realistic.
- Educates the impacted organization about the key elements/deliverables of the Quality Agreement.
- Acts as Subject Matter Expert (SME) and provides strategic support for client audits in partnership with the PQS team members.
- Supports or hosts client onsite visits and establishes ways of working with Partner QA.
- Participates in cross-functional Program Kickoffs (Internal & Client).
- Represents Quality on the project team.
- Organizes, leads, and facilitates Quality workstream (internal and external) and determines meeting cadence for each program.
- Provides a standard agenda and meeting summaries such as discussion points, decisions, action-risk log. Implements a Quality subteam meeting cadence which enables appropriate internal discussions and client engagement/communication.
- Assigns and tracks specific action items with functional accountabilities.
- Analyzes, tracks and reports programs quality performance through periodic Management Reviews with clients.
- Provides timely responses to clients including but not limited to communications involving deviations, change management, product disposition, and all other quality agreement deliverables.
- Works with Sr. Director PQM on client interactions, receives coaching and adjusts in agile manner to ensure success of program(s).
- Supports Quality review/verification of high-level documents, including, process control strategy, product specification, and PPQ protocols/reports.
- Performs other duties, as assigned.
